Composio benchmarks Kimi K3 harnesses with $0.22–$2 per-task cost swing

Composio found Kimi K3 success stayed near 71–79% across three harnesses while median token use ranged from 61K to 340K and cost from $0.22 to $2 per task. Cline also shipped a Kimi K3 CLI update.

TL;DR

  • Kimi K3’s harness tax finally has a dollar figure: success stayed in a 71 to 79% band across three harnesses while median token use ranged from 61K to 340K, as thursdai_pod’s summary put it.
  • Median per-task cost swung from $0.22 in Kimi Code to $2.00 in Claude Code, according to thursdai_pod’s cost breakdown.
  • Cline used Kimi K3 to improve its own harness, moving Terminal-Bench 2.1 from 77.5% to 88.8% and run cost from $79 to $49.8 in 17 hours, per Cline’s RSI post.
  • The rollout is already in tools: Cline’s CLI update shipped npm i -g cline, Kimi_Moonshot named Together as a day-zero partner, and OpenCode added Kimi K3 to OpenCode Zen.
  • Harness compatibility is still messy: HamelHusain called K3 in Codex Desktop a “big mistake,” while bigeagle_xd pointed to Codex’s Responses API requirement.

Kimi’s Hugging Face model card describes a 2.8T-parameter open-weight multimodal model with a 1M-token context window, and the technical report says KDA, Attention Residuals, and Stable LatentMoE drove a 2.5x scaling-efficiency gain over K2. OpenRouter’s Kimi K3 page already lists multi-provider routing for the same model at $3/M input and $15/M output. Cline’s blog post adds the agent nerd candy: a single recursive self-improvement run that turned harness patches into a Terminal-Bench score jump.

The 28-task harness spread

Composio ran Kimi K3 through Kimi Code, Hermes, and Claude Code on the same 28 tasks, according to thursdai_pod’s summary. The token counts came from thursdai_pod’s median-token post, and the success and latency counts came from the outcome post.

| Harness | Solved | Median tokens | Median time |
| --- | ---: | ---: | ---: |
| Kimi Code | 22/28 | 61K | 297s |
| Hermes | 21/28 | 67K | 179s |
| Claude Code | 20/28 | 340K | 348s |

Claude Code used 5.6x more median tokens than Kimi Code while solving two fewer tasks. Hermes was the fastest run, with token use close to Kimi Code.

Per-task dollars

Prices widened the gap: thursdai_pod’s cost post put Kimi Code at $0.22/task, Hermes at $0.28/task, and Claude Code at $2.00/task. That is a 9.1x spread for a 7.1-point success-rate spread.

Composio’s separate 14-task agentic benchmark said K3 matched Claude Fable 5 task for task, with 9 passes and 5 failures, and did better on the hardest task, 11 of 13 checks versus Fable’s 9 of 13 in Composio’s comparison. The same post said roughly 95% of token spend on agentic tasks comes from input tokens.

Composio called the price gap “pretty dramatic” in a reply. When asked about Kimi taking longer in the comparison, Composio said the delay was probably hosting-related in another reply.

Cline’s recursive harness patch

Cline’s experiment is the cleaner harness story: one 17-hour run took Kimi K3 in the Cline harness from 77.5% to 88.8% on Terminal-Bench 2.1 and cut run cost from $79 to $49.8, according to Cline’s RSI post. The attached chart labels the after state as “one prompt, zero benchmark-specific fixes.”

Cline’s full-run cost chart put the same $49.8 Kimi K3 run against $400 for GPT-5.6 Terra and $552 for Claude Fable 5 in its Terminal-Bench comparison. Cline also said the open-source harness can be forked and rerun with another model in the follow-up, while the blog post includes the writeup.

Open weights, hosted routing

Moonshot teased Kimi K3 as “open weights, coming soon” in Kimi_Moonshot’s preview, and bridgemindai captured the provider race version of the release: 2.8T parameters on Hugging Face, with fast inference providers getting a copy.

Day-zero access spread across agent surfaces fast:

  • Cline: Cline’s CLI update says npm i -g cline exposes Kimi’s self-improvements, and Cline’s ClinePass reply describes a new-user promo with about $60 of Kimi K3 API usage per month.
  • Together: Kimi_Moonshot thanked Together AI as a day-zero launch partner for K3 access optimized for coding agents and production workloads.
  • OpenCode: OpenCode added Kimi K3 to OpenCode Zen.
  • Morph: Morph made Kimi K3 available directly, through OpenRouter, and through Vercel Gateway.

Closed-harness friction

The awkward edge case is closed harnesses. HamelHusain’s test called K3 in Codex Desktop a “big mistake,” and his reply said it “gets really weird and sends json messages.”

A protocol mismatch may explain part of it: bigeagle_xd said Codex needs the Responses API and Kimi does not provide it. In a follow-up, HamelHusain said OpenCode and pi were fine, while customized harness behavior can get in the way.

OpenBench is turning that friction into something measurable. mattlam_ linked an easier runner, and mattlam_’s caveat said Cursor data was self-reported while Codex repeatedly showed high token usage.
